Facebook drunk girl pic It was only a matter of time before someone made a movie about the social networking phenomenon that is Facebook but most of us probably didn't expect that someone to be…Aaron Sorkin. That's right, NY Mag uncovered Sorkin's recently created Facebook group where he drops this little nugget: "I've just agreed to write a movie for Sony and producer Scott Rudin about how Facebook was invented. I figured a good first step in my preparation would be finding out what Facebook is, so I've started this page. (Actually it was started by my researcher, Ian Reichbach, because my grandmother has more Internet savvy than I do and she's been dead for 33 years.)" Most people probably expected a Facebook movie to be a throwaway teeny bopper sex romp but with Sorkin behind it, this thing could actually be good. Wow, that's a little scary.
